Application Scenarios
In a recent project to modernize a mid-sized power generation facility, engineers faced the daunting task of upgrading the outdated AS 220 control system without replacing the vast network of existing field I/O cabinets. The solution revolved around the Siemens 6DS1332-8RR. By installing a migration rack equipped with a PCS 7 system and a TPM 478-2 module, the existing expansion units were kept active. The Siemens 6DS1332-8RR was deployed to provide the I/O bus connections A and B, effectively acting as a translator and bridge between the new, high-performance control system and the legacy hardware. This approach allowed the plant to retain its substantial investment in existing instrumentation and wiring while gaining the advanced capabilities of a modern DCS.

Parameters
| Main Parameters | Value/Description |
|---|---|
| Product Model | 6DS1332-8RR (also known as series NT1332) |
| Manufacturer | Siemens (Germany) |
| Product Category | I/O Bus Control Module / Bus Coupler |
| Primary Function | Manages I/O bus connections A and B for expansion units in Teleperm M/D systems |
| Compatible Systems | AS 220/230/235 systems, Teleperm M/ME, Teleperm D |
| Communication Protocol | SINEC L1 / Token Bus |
| Operating Voltage | 24V DC |
| Weight | Approx. 0.4 – 0.8 kg |
| Physical Dimensions | Approx. 7.6 cm x 20.3 cm x 25.4 cm |
| Mounting | Rack-mountable / Panel Mount |
| Special Feature | Galvanic isolation (photoelectric) |
Technical Principles and Innovative Values
- Innovation Point 1: Legacy System Migration Enabler. The Siemens 6DS1332-8RR excels as a migration tool. Its primary innovation is its ability to seamlessly connect classic Teleperm M I/O hardware to a modern PCS 7-based migration rack via the TPM 478-2 interface. This allows plants to upgrade their control logic and HMI to modern standards while fully leveraging their existing investment in I/O wiring and cabinets, a critical advantage for budget-conscious asset owners.
- Innovation Point 2: High-Integrity Bus Communication. As a dedicated bus control module, the Siemens 6DS1332-8RR is responsible for the robust management of the SINEC L1/Token Bus communication protocol. It ensures deterministic and reliable data exchange, which is essential for time-critical process control applications. The module’s design includes features like photoelectric isolation to protect the central control system from electrical noise and surges common in harsh industrial settings, ensuring stable operation.
